全域性變數及輸出語句

2022-02-25 08:54:20 字數 661 閱讀 9417

全域性變數是系統定義好的變數,主要反映sql資料庫的操作狀態

全域性變數以@@開頭。

舉例:@@identity : 返回最後插入的表示值

t-sql

語句的錯誤號。

常用的輸出語句:

1.print : 結果有訊息中從文的形式顯示。

2.select : 只在結果中以網格的形式顯示,查詢是

select

特殊的用法。

@@identity :如往資料表中插入一行資料,

insert into

表名 (列1

,列2) values (列1

,列2)

插入成功後select @@identity 顯示它的標識列。

@@error

select @@error : 沒有錯誤顯示

0使用select 輸出別名,查詢是

select

語句特殊的用法。

select @@error as 錯誤號

select @@error 錯誤

select 『錯誤號』=@@error

執行是可以的

使用print輸出,用』+』來連線,要求』+』左右鏈結的資料型別要一致

print 『錯誤號』+@@error

varchar  inger型別

static全域性變數 全域性變數

1 全域性變數 外部變數 的說明之前再冠以static 就構成了靜態的全域性變數。全域性變數本身就是靜態儲存方式,靜態全域性變數當然也是靜態儲存方式。這兩者在儲存方式上並無不同。這兩者的區別在於非靜態全域性變數的作用域是整個源程式,當乙個源程式由多個原始檔組成時,非靜態的全域性變數在各個原始檔中都是...

python全域性變數語句global

在python中使用函式體外的變數,可以使用global語句 變數可以是區域性域或者全域性域。定義在函式內的變數有區域性作用域,在乙個模組中最高端別的變數有全域性作用域。在編譯器理論裡著名的 龍書 中,阿霍 賽西和烏爾曼作了如下總結 宣告適用的程式的範圍被稱為了宣告的作用域。在乙個過程中,如果名字在...

全域性變數和靜態全域性變數

全域性變數和區域性變數是從變數的作用域的角度劃分。靜態變數和動態變數是從變數的記憶體分配的角度劃分。全域性變數本身就是靜態儲存方式,靜態全域性變數當然也是靜態儲存方式。這兩者在儲存方式上並無不同,區別在於非靜態全域性變數的作用域是整個源程式,當乙個源程式由多個原始檔組成時,非靜態的全域性變數在各個原...